全国旗舰校区

不同学习城市 同样授课品质

北京

深圳

上海

广州

郑州

大连

武汉

成都

西安

杭州

青岛

重庆

长沙

哈尔滨

南京

太原

沈阳

合肥

贵阳

济南

下一个校区
就在你家门口
+
当前位置:首页  >  技术问答  > 详情

java list快速排序的方法

匿名提问者2023-09-27

java list快速排序的方法

推荐答案

  Java 提供了内置的快速排序方法,可以方便地对列表进行排序。这个方法位于 java.util.Collections 类中,称为 sort() 方法。下面我们将使用这个库函数来实现快速排序。

千锋教育

  import java.util.ArrayList;

  import java.util.Collections;

  import java.util.List;

  public class QuickSortUsingLibrary {

  public static void main(String[] args) {

  // 创建一个整数列表

  List numbers = new ArrayList<>();

  numbers.add(5);

  numbers.add(2);

  numbers.add(9);

  numbers.add(1);

  numbers.add(4);

  // 使用 Collections.sort() 方法对列表进行快速排序

  Collections.sort(numbers);

  System.out.println("快速排序结果:" + numbers);

  }

  }

 

  上述代码中,我们首先创建了一个整数列表 numbers,然后使用 Collections.sort() 方法对列表进行快速排序。这个方法会自动按升序排序列表。

  时间复杂度和稳定性

  Java 中的快速排序库函数采用了一种高效的排序算法,平均时间复杂度为 O(n*log(n))。然而,它也是不稳定的排序算法。

相关问答

java list快速排序的方法

python3 with用法怎么操作

java文件写入覆盖的方法

java如何比较日期大小

java类如何获取项目相对路径

开班信息 更多>>

课程名称
全部学科
咨询

HTML5大前端

Java分布式开发

Python数据分析

Linux运维+云计算

全栈软件测试

大数据+数据智能

智能物联网+嵌入式

网络安全

全链路UI/UE设计

Unity游戏开发

新媒体短视频直播电商

影视剪辑包装

游戏原画

    在线咨询 免费试学 教程领取